Requirements
  • Must be at least 15 years old.
  • Must possess American Red Cross Lifeguard Certification.
  • Must understand and support The Salvation Army’s mission as a church and social services organization.
  • Must be able to work a minimum of one weekend shift per month.
Responsibilities
  • Enforce pool and facility rules to provide a safe environment for members, visitors, and employees.
  • Respond appropriately to emergency situations and maintain constant observation of assigned areas to identify danger.
  • Caution swimmers regarding unsafe areas and actions and maintain order in swimming areas.
  • Rescue swimmers in danger of drowning.
  • Provide first aid, rescue breathing, cardiopulmonary resuscitation, and automated external defibrillator assistance when necessary.
  • Assist with aquatic programming.
  • Inspect and maintain the cleanliness of swimming pool areas, locker rooms, restrooms, trash cans, cleaning equipment, aquatic equipment storage areas, and other assigned areas.
  • Set up and break down facility equipment under supervision.
  • Help set up and break down the Swim Meet Timing System under supervision.
  • Test or provide information for required pool documents daily.
  • Communicate with co-workers and customers in person and over the phone.
  • Attend required staff meetings and in-service training.
  • Learn and adhere to all policies and procedures.
  • Represent The Salvation Army’s mission in actions, programs, trainings, customer relations, and operations.
  • Perform other duties within the scope of the role as assigned by supervisors.

The Salvation Army is an international Christian nonprofit delivering social services through regional territories. The organization provides emergency assistance, shelters, rehabilitation, youth programs, disaster response, community services, worship, and thrift retail. It serves individuals and families in need, donors, volunteers, congregations, and communities across its service territories. Its operating model centers on locally delivered programs supported by territorial leadership, fundraising, retail operations, logistics, facilities, and administration. Teams work across social services, counseling, retail, logistics, fundraising, ministry, facilities, finance, and community programs. Teams support coordinated daily delivery.
